Even if the anatomy is correct this isn't a very interesting shot. It's a straight on shot of a very mundane looking king. He doesn't look like a king, not even a viking king.
His facial expression is boring and lucky for you it conveys boredom. A lazy king really would have more weight on him. hunched over maybe?

I suggest you draw this with paper and pencil before you haphazardly jump into a pixel piece. On paper you can easily sketch 5 different thumbnails in 5 minutes, try it.

Find references if you can. images.google.com is a great place to start. There are a few good stock photo websites. Also look at some other art work involving vikings and things associated with vikings. Try to get a reference picture for everything you're going to make. 2-3 pictures for each piece should put you in the right direction.

One very useful piece of knowledge I can share with you is to stop studying pixel art.

Make sketches as much as you can, use references even after you think you got everything down pat.
A lot of us here aren't just pixel artists. I am a sculptor and screen printer.

When I make pixel art I usually do it with a solid idea in mind, sometimes a sketch. If I'm doing work that I'm getting paid for I have multiple sketches and a handful of references pinned up around my computer or opened in my computer.

If you can paint the Mona Lisa with oils you can probably make something nice in with pixel art. If you can sketch a sketch a bird you can probably pixel push one into existence.
